How Does Stainless Steel Perform in Coffee Bottle Tumblers?

Stainless steel, particularly 18/8 pro-grade, is a popular choice for coffee tumblers due to its excellent thermal insulation properties and resistance to corrosion. It can maintain the temperature of beverages for extended periods, making it ideal for both hot and cold drinks.

Pros: Stainless steel is highly durable and resistant to rust and staining, ensuring a long lifespan even with frequent use. It is also easy to clean and does not retain flavors, which is crucial for coffee drinkers.

Cons: The initial cost of stainless steel tumblers can be higher than other materials. Additionally, manufacturing processes can be more complex, requiring specialized equipment.

Impact on Application: Stainless steel is compatible with a wide range of beverages, including acidic drinks like coffee, without the risk of leaching harmful substances.

Considerations for International Buyers: Compliance with international standards such as ASTM for material quality is essential. Buyers should also consider local preferences regarding aesthetics and branding, as stainless steel can be customized with various finishes.

What Role Does Plastic Play in Coffee Bottle Tumblers?

Plastic, particularly BPA-free polypropylene or Tritan™, is often used for lightweight tumblers. These materials offer good thermal insulation and can be produced in various colors and designs.

Pros: Plastic tumblers are generally less expensive and lighter than their stainless steel counterparts, making them ideal for promotional products or budget-conscious consumers.

Cons: They may not provide the same level of thermal retention as stainless steel and can be susceptible to scratches and wear over time. Additionally, some plastics can retain odors or flavors.

Impact on Application: While suitable for cold beverages, plastic may not be ideal for hot liquids, as it can warp or degrade under high temperatures.

Considerations for International Buyers: Ensuring compliance with food safety standards is critical. Buyers should also be aware of regional preferences for eco-friendly materials, as there is a growing demand for sustainable options.

How Does Glass Compare in Coffee Bottle Tumblers?

Glass tumblers offer an aesthetic appeal and are often used for premium products. Borosilicate glass is commonly chosen for its thermal resistance.

Pros: Glass provides excellent flavor preservation and does not leach chemicals, making it safe for hot beverages. It also offers a premium look and feel, which can enhance brand perception.

Cons: Glass is more fragile than other materials, making it less suitable for outdoor or rugged use. It is also heavier, which can be a drawback for portability.

Impact on Application: Glass is compatible with all types of beverages but requires careful handling to avoid breakage.

Considerations for International Buyers: Buyers should consider the logistics of shipping glass products, as they require more robust packaging to prevent damage. Additionally, compliance with glass safety standards is necessary.

What Advantages Does Silicone Offer in Coffee Bottle Tumblers?

Silicone is often used for lids or sleeves on tumblers due to its flexibility and durability. It can withstand high temperatures, making it suitable for hot beverages.

Pros: Silicone is lightweight, flexible, and resistant to temperature extremes. It also provides a non-slip grip, enhancing user experience.

Cons: While silicone is durable, it may not offer the same level of insulation as stainless steel or glass. Additionally, it can absorb some odors over time.

Impact on Application: Silicone is best used in conjunction with other materials, such as for seals or lids, rather than as the primary material for the tumbler body.

Considerations for International Buyers: Buyers should ensure that silicone products meet food safety standards and consider the environmental impact of silicone production.

In-depth Look: Manufacturing Processes and Quality Assurance for coffee bottle tumbler

What Are the Main Stages of Manufacturing Coffee Bottle Tumblers?

The manufacturing of coffee bottle tumblers involves several critical stages, each designed to ensure the final product meets quality and performance expectations. The primary stages include material preparation, forming, assembly, and finishing.

Material Preparation

The manufacturing process begins with sourcing high-quality materials, predominantly food-grade stainless steel (often 18/8 or 304 grade) for its durability, resistance to corrosion, and ability to maintain the purity of beverages. Suppliers must ensure that the raw materials meet international food safety standards. This stage includes cutting the steel into appropriate dimensions and preparing any additional components, such as lids, straws, and insulating layers.

What Techniques Are Used in Forming Coffee Tumblers?

Forming techniques are crucial in shaping the tumblers. Common methods include:

  • Deep Drawing: A process where a flat sheet of metal is drawn into a mold to form the tumbler’s body. This technique ensures uniform thickness and enhances structural integrity.
  • Injection Molding: Used for plastic components like lids and straws, this method involves injecting molten plastic into molds to create precise shapes.
  • Welding and Joining: For tumblers that require multiple parts, welding techniques, including laser welding and spot welding, ensure a strong bond between components.

These methods not only contribute to the functionality of the tumblers but also affect aesthetics, as manufacturers often aim for a sleek, modern design.

How Is the Assembly Process Conducted for Tumblers?

Once the components are formed, the assembly process begins. This stage typically involves:

  • Combining Components: Skilled workers or automated systems bring together the body, lid, and any additional features such as straws or silicone grips.
  • Quality Checks: At various points during assembly, quality checks are performed to ensure all parts fit correctly and function as intended.

Effective assembly processes minimize defects and reduce the likelihood of product returns, which is crucial for maintaining good relationships with B2B partners.

What Finishing Techniques Enhance the Quality of Coffee Tumblers?

The finishing stage adds the final touches to the tumblers, enhancing both appearance and functionality. Key techniques include:

  • Electropolishing: This process improves surface finish and corrosion resistance by removing imperfections from the metal surface.
  • Coating: Tumblers may receive powder coating or painting to provide color and additional protection against wear and tear.
  • Printing: Custom logos or designs can be added through screen printing or laser engraving, appealing to branding needs for B2B buyers.

These finishing touches not only enhance the visual appeal but also contribute to the tumbler’s durability and customer satisfaction.

What Quality Assurance Standards Are Relevant for Coffee Tumblers?

Quality assurance is paramount in the manufacturing process, particularly for international B2B transactions. Adhering to recognized standards ensures that products meet safety and performance criteria. Key standards include:

  • ISO 9001: This international standard focuses on quality management systems, ensuring consistent quality in products and services.
  • CE Marking: Required for products sold in the European Economic Area, it indicates compliance with health, safety, and environmental protection standards.
  • FDA Compliance: For products intended for food and beverage use, compliance with FDA regulations is essential in the United States.

B2B buyers should ensure that their suppliers are certified in these standards, as it reflects a commitment to quality and safety.

What Are the Key Quality Control Checkpoints in the Manufacturing Process?

Quality control (QC) checkpoints are critical at various stages of the manufacturing process. These include:

  • Incoming Quality Control (IQC): Raw materials are inspected for quality before production begins. This includes testing the composition of stainless steel and ensuring that all components meet specified standards.
  • In-Process Quality Control (IPQC): During manufacturing, checks are performed to monitor processes such as forming and assembly. This ensures that any deviations are caught early.
  • Final Quality Control (FQC): Once production is complete, a comprehensive inspection of finished products is conducted. This includes testing for leaks, thermal performance, and visual inspections for defects.

Implementing these checkpoints minimizes the risk of defective products reaching the market, which is crucial for maintaining brand reputation and customer trust.

Comprehensive Cost and Pricing Analysis for coffee bottle tumbler Sourcing

What Are the Key Cost Components in Sourcing Coffee Bottle Tumblers?

When sourcing coffee bottle tumblers, it is essential to understand the various cost components that contribute to the overall price. The primary cost elements include:

  • Materials: High-quality materials such as 18/8 stainless steel are commonly used for insulation and durability. The choice of material significantly affects the cost, as premium materials typically command higher prices.

  • Labor: Labor costs vary depending on the manufacturing location. Regions with lower labor costs may offer competitive pricing but could impact the quality and consistency of the product.

  • Manufacturing Overhead: This encompasses the costs related to factory operation, including utilities, equipment maintenance, and administrative expenses. Overhead can vary widely based on the manufacturer’s efficiency and location.

  • Tooling: Initial tooling costs can be significant, especially for custom designs. These costs are usually amortized over a larger production run, making it essential to consider volume when negotiating.

  • Quality Control (QC): Implementing stringent quality control measures is crucial for ensuring product reliability. The costs associated with QC can include testing, inspection, and compliance with international quality standards.

  • Logistics: Shipping and handling costs can vary based on distance, mode of transport, and shipping terms. International buyers should consider additional customs duties and tariffs.

  • Margin: Suppliers typically build a profit margin into their pricing, which can range based on market conditions and competitive pricing strategies.

How Do Pricing Influencers Affect the Cost of Coffee Bottle Tumblers?

Several factors can influence the pricing of coffee bottle tumblers, particularly for B2B buyers:

  • Volume and Minimum Order Quantity (MOQ): Higher order volumes often lead to lower per-unit costs. Suppliers may offer significant discounts for bulk purchases, making it advantageous for businesses to consolidate orders.

  • Specifications and Customization: Custom designs, colors, and features can increase production costs. Buyers should weigh the benefits of customization against the potential price increase.

  • Material Quality and Certifications: Tumblers made from higher-quality materials or those that comply with specific certifications (like BPA-free or FDA-approved) may cost more but can enhance brand reputation and customer satisfaction.

  • Supplier Factors: The supplier’s reputation, reliability, and service quality can impact pricing. Established suppliers with a proven track record may charge premium prices due to their reliability.

  • Incoterms: The agreed-upon Incoterms (International Commercial Terms) can significantly affect the total landed cost. Terms like FOB (Free on Board) or CIF (Cost, Insurance, and Freight) will dictate who bears the shipping and insurance costs.

What Are Common Trade Terms Used in the Coffee Tumbler Industry?

Familiarity with industry jargon is essential for effective communication and negotiation in the B2B landscape. Here are several terms commonly encountered in the coffee tumbler market:

  1. OEM (Original Equipment Manufacturer)
    This term refers to companies that produce products that are sold under another brand’s name. For B2B buyers, partnering with an OEM can lead to lower costs and customized products tailored to specific market needs.

  2. MOQ (Minimum Order Quantity)
    MOQ is the smallest number of units that a supplier is willing to sell. Understanding MOQ is critical for buyers, as it can affect inventory levels and cash flow. Negotiating favorable MOQs can help businesses manage costs and stock availability effectively.

  3. RFQ (Request for Quotation)
    An RFQ is a document sent to suppliers requesting pricing and other relevant information for a specific product. For B2B buyers, issuing an RFQ can streamline the procurement process, enabling them to compare offers from multiple suppliers efficiently.

  4. Incoterms (International Commercial Terms)
    These are standardized terms used in international trade to define the responsibilities of buyers and sellers. Familiarity with Incoterms helps B2B buyers understand shipping costs, risk management, and delivery responsibilities, which are vital for smooth transactions.

  5. Lead Time
    Lead time is the period from placing an order to receiving it. Understanding lead times is crucial for inventory management and meeting customer demand. Buyers should always clarify lead times with suppliers to avoid stock shortages.

  6. Certification Standards
    Many coffee tumblers must meet specific safety and quality certifications (e.g., FDA, CE). Knowing which certifications are relevant can help buyers ensure that their products comply with regulations, enhancing marketability and consumer trust.
